在进行织梦网站的迁移时,除了将网站文件和数据库完整地复制到新的服务器外,还需要对数据库配置文件进行相应的修改。这是因为新的服务器环境可能与原服务器存在差异,直接使用旧的配置文件可能导致网站无法正常运行。以下是具体的修改步骤:
首先,确保你已经成功将织梦网站的所有文件上传到了新服务器,并且数据库也已正确导入。接下来,你需要登录到你的ftp客户端,找到并下载根目录下的`config.php`文件。这个文件包含了织梦网站的数据库连接信息。
打开`config.php`文件,通常你会看到类似以下的内容:
```php
<?php
//数据库主机
$cfg_dbhost = ⁄\'旧服务器ip地址⁄\';
//数据库用户名
$cfg_dbuser = ⁄\'旧用户名⁄\';
//数据库密码
$cfg_dbpwd = ⁄\'旧密码⁄\';
//数据库名称
$cfg_dbname = ⁄\'旧数据库名⁄\';
//数据库前缀
$cfg_dbprefix = ⁄\'dede_⁄\';
//数据库编码
$cfg_db_language = ⁄\'utf8⁄\';
?>
```
你需要将上述内容中的旧服务器ip地址、旧用户名、旧密码和旧数据库名分别替换为新服务器的相关信息。例如,如果你的新数据库是在阿里云上创建的,那么你需要登录阿里云管理后台获取数据库的公网ip地址、用户名、密码以及数据库名称。
修改完成后,保存文件并重新上传到服务器的根目录下,覆盖原来的`config.php`文件。此时,你应该检查一下新服务器上的权限设置,确保上传的`config.php`文件具有可读写权限。
验证数据库配置是否成功
完成以上操作后,打开浏览器访问你的织梦网站域名,查看页面是否能够正常加载。如果页面正常显示,说明数据库配置已经成功;如果遇到错误提示,比如“无法连接数据库”等,需要再次检查`config.php`文件中的数据库信息是否填写正确。
另外,还有一种方法可以快速确认数据库连接是否成功。在织梦网站的根目录下创建一个名为`test.php`的文件,内容如下:
```php
<?php
$link = mysqli_connect(⁄\'新服务器ip地址⁄\', ⁄\'新用户名⁄\', ⁄\'新密码⁄\', ⁄\'新数据库名⁄\');
if (!$link) {
die(⁄\'could not connect: ⁄\' . mysqli_error());
}
echo ⁄\'connected successfully⁄\';
mysqli_close($link);
?>
```
将此文件上传至服务器,然后通过浏览器访问该文件的url。如果页面显示“connected successfully”,则说明数据库连接配置无误。
总结
综上所述,在织梦网站迁移后,修改数据库配置文件是一个非常关键的步骤。只要按照上述步骤逐一操作,就能顺利完成配置并使网站恢复正常运行。记住,任何配置更改之后都需要仔细检查以避免潜在问题的发生。希望本文提供的信息对你有所帮助!